One of the predicates of anti-Covid-vaxxers insinuations such as "NEW - FDA orders Pfizer, Moderna to update COVID mRNA vaccine warnings, adding heart injury risk, ..." is the difficulty of finding evidence from the time frame of the claim. In this case, the difficulty of finding official instructions about the three Covid vaccines used in the 2021 and 2022 time frame. Well with DDG, a well composed search phrase, and a little patience (in alphabetical, not chronological, order of authorization):

Janssen / Johnson & Johnson, from the FDA, 2021, https://www.fda.gov/media/146305/download

Quote
Myocarditis and Pericarditis

Myocarditis (inflammation of the heart muscle) and pericarditis (inflammation of the lining outside
the heart) have occurred in some people who have received the vaccine. In most of these people,
symptoms began within 8 days following vaccination. The chance of having this occur is very low.
You should seek medical attention right away if you have any of the following symptoms after
receiving the vaccine:

• Chest pain

• Shortness of breath

• Feelings of having a fast-beating, fluttering, or pounding heart

Moderna, June/17/2022, https://www.memorialcare.org/sites/default/files/_images/content/coronavirus/vaccine-resources/MHS_VaccineClinics_ModernaEUARecipientFactSheet12yandOlder_2022_06_17.pdf

Quote
Side effects that have been reported during post-authorization use of the vaccine include:
• Severe allergic reactions
Myocarditis (inflammation of the heart muscle)
Pericarditis (inflammation of the lining outside the heart)
• Fainting in association with injection of the vaccine

Among the listed possible contra-indications for receiving the Moderna vaccine are:

Quote
have had myocarditis (inflammation of the heart muscle) or pericarditis (inflammation of
the lining outside the heart)

Pfizer, 8 December 2022, https://labeling.pfizer.com/ShowLabeling.aspx?id=14472

Quote
Side effects that have been reported with these vaccines include:
  Severe allergic reactions
  Non-severe allergic reactions such as rash, itching, hives, or swelling of the face
  Myocarditis (inflammation of the heart muscle)
  Pericarditis (inflammation of the lining outside the heart)

Among the listed possible contra-indications for receiving the Pfizer vaccine are:

Quote
have had myocarditis (inflammation of the heart muscle) or pericarditis
(inflammation of the lining outside the heart)

Information was not "denied" or "withheld".
